The current situation of MSMEs in Mexico and informal trade post-covid-19

The objective of this research is to analyze the current economic situation of micro, small and medium-sized enterprises (MSMEs) in Mexico and post-covid-19 informal trade. To answer the research question What is the current situation of the entities under study and informal commerce in Mexico, post covid-19?, the type of research is mixed, quantitative because it analyzes the data issued by official sources, such as INEGI about existing establishments and the representation of each state of the Mexican Republic in informal commerce and qualitative because it is based on the grounded theory, it contrasts with findings from other national and international research that speak of the current situation of the companies under study. The results obtained show: that the companies in question used informal trade to survive the pandemic. It is concluded that MSMEs are used to high economic turbulence and health pandemics such as covid-19 and that they will be experiencing the aftermath for several years, before reaching economic normality in the country.
